Heroic Romances of Ireland THE COMBAT AT THE FORD / INTRODUCTION / THE COMBAT AT THE FORD / SPECIAL NOTE; lines 6372-6463 confidence: high
The charioteer says Fer Diad will come with 'plaiting and haircutting and washing and bathing' and advises Cuchulain to seek the same adorning where Emer is; Cuchulain goes that night and spends it with his wife.
Fer Diad is expected to arrive with plaiting, haircutting, washing, and bathing; Cuchulain is advised to seek the same adorning; the note cites other warriors adorning before battle.
